Celtic's Caldwell in demand across Europe...cough!

If press speculation is to be believed, Celtic defender Gary Caldwell is one of the most sought after defenders in Germany.

Okay, that may be a slight exaggeration but newspapers have claimed the 27-year-old Scotland international has attracted the interest of Wolfsburg, Hannover '96 and Schalke 04. Burnley are also thought to be monitoring the situation.

Caldwell is out of contract at the end of the season and, with negotiations regarding extending his Celtic career seemingly unlikely to succeed, Celtic may opt to sell the player in January for a small fee rather than receive nothing on the summer.

How a player such as Caldwell can be linked with three fairly sizeable German clubs is unclear but if his agent hopes to stir up interest, he may have overplayed his hand. A move to Burnley is believable at a push, only if because Caldwell's brother is captain of the English Premier League side.

But does anybody really believe Caldwell has attracted the attention of clubs across Europe? He may have performed well last season - which may have been because others played poorly - but it's not as though he as been an impenetrable rock in the heart of the defence.
